About Con Edison
Con Edison provides energy services to more than 10 million people and businesses across New York City and Westchester. The company operates as a public utility with a focus on system reliability and the transition to a net-zero energy model. It currently invests in infrastructure and technology to reduce reliance on fossil fuels. The organization employs over 10,000 people and maintains its headquarters in New York.
